JSPM

  • Created
  • Published
  • Downloads 226
  • Score
    100M100P100Q97318F

Mojito provides an architecture, components and tools for developers to build complex web applications faster.

Package Exports

  • mojito

This package does not declare an exports field, so the exports above have been automatically detected and optimized by JSPM instead. If any package subpath is missing, it is recommended to post an issue to the original package (mojito) to support the "exports" field. If that is not possible, create a JSPM override to customize the exports field for this package.

Readme

Black Duck OS 2012 Rookie of the Year

Yahoo! Mojito

Mojito is the JavaScript library implementing Cocktails, a JavaScript-based on-line/off-line, multi-device, hosted application platform.

Build Status

Installation

via GitHub

$ git clone git://github.com/yahoo/mojito.git
$ cd mojito
$ npm install -g .
$ npm install .

via npm

$ npm install -g mojito

Quick Start

Create an app and install local Mojito:

$ mojito create app hello
$ cd hello
$ npm install .

Create a mojit:

$ mojito create mojit HelloMojit

Start the server:

$ mojito start

Go to URL:

http://localhost:8666/@HelloMojit/index

Run Unit Tests:

$ mojito test app .

Generate documentation:

$ mojito docs app hello

Documentation

General

Contributing to Documentation

Mojito documentation is present in /docs directory. To generate HTML documentation run the following commands from the documentation directories.

$ cd docs/dev_guide
$ make html

Please note that in order to generate the documentation you will need Sphinx.

API Documentation

Discussion/Forums

http://developer.yahoo.com/forum/Yahoo-Mojito

Licensing and Contributions

Mojito is licensed under a BSD license. To contribute to the Mojito project, please see Contributing.

The Mojito project is a meritocratic, consensus-based community project which allows anyone to contribute and gain additional responsibilities.